JOB OVERVIEW
The Benefit Consultant is responsible for client satisfaction, service delivery, and vendor management while supporting the development of innovative, data-driven strategies to optimize complex Health & Welfare benefit programs.WHAT YOU’LL DO
Support development and execution of benefit strategies for large, self-funded clients Develop cost-containment strategies across medical, pharmacy, and disability programs Analyze claims/utilization trends and identify improvement opportunities Lead vendor evaluations, RFPs, procurement, implementation, and performance tracking Communicate industry trends, benchmarks, and regulatory updates Client Management Serve as primary day-to-day client contact and manage vendor relationships Oversee project management for deliverables, compliance deadlines, and annual planning Manage RFP processes, renewals, contract negotiations, and vendor implementations Ensure timely, accurate execution of deliverables with actuarial and internal teams Support compliance (e.g., 5500 filings, plan documents, regulatory adherence) Resolve escalated claims and support employee communications and enrollment activities Client Relationship & Reporting Partner with clients to define benefit goals and strategies Deliver financial reporting, analysis, and benchmarking insights Review and finalize client reporting deliverables Business Development & Team Collaboration Assist with new business opportunities and strategy development Contribute to internal process improvements and team initiativesWHAT YOU'LL BRING
5–10 years of experience in insurance, employee benefits, or HR Strong knowledge of Health & Welfare programs (self-funded medical, Rx, dental, vision, disability, life, absence, etc.) Experience managing large, self-funded clients in consulting or brokerage Full-cycle RFP experience Bachelor’s degree or equivalent experience Experience designing and implementing benefit plans Underwriting experience preferred Insurance license (or ability to obtain) Strong communication, analytical, and problem-solving skills Project management and ability to manage multiple priorities Experience with data analysis and self-funded plan financials Knowledge of regulations and compliance requirements Proficiency in Microsoft Office and large data sets Ability to work independently, collaboratively, and in a fast-paced environment High level of professionalism, accountability, and client service focus Additional Requirements Ability to maintain confidentiality and interact with executive stakeholders Willingness to travel and work outside standard hours as neededCOMPENSATION
